Selecting the Best Food-Grade Conveyor System for Your Needs

systems are essential in the food industry for the efficient and sanitary movement of food products throughout the production process. Food-grade conveyor systems are specifically designed to meet the unique needs of food processing and handling, ensuring compliance with safety regulations and maintaining the quality of food products. Selecting the best food-grade conveyor system for your needs is crucial to the success of your food processing operation.

Factors to Consider When Selecting a Food-Grade System

When choosing a food-grade conveyor system, there are several factors to consider to ensure that it meets your specific requirements. The following are some of the key factors to take into account when selecting a conveyor system for your food processing operation.

First, you need to consider the types of food products that will be processed and transported on the conveyor system. Different food products have different handling requirements, and the conveyor system should be designed to accommodate the specific needs of the products. For example, delicate food items may require gentle handling to prevent damage, while bulk solids may require a heavy-duty conveyor system to withstand the weight and abrasion.

Another important factor to consider is the hygienic design of the loading conveyor system. Food-grade conveyor systems need to be easy to clean and sanitize to prevent contamination and ensure food safety. Look for conveyor systems with smooth, cleanable surfaces, minimal horizontal surfaces, and removable parts for thorough cleaning.

The configuration and layout of the production facility also play a significant role in selecting the right conveyor system. Consider the available space, the flow of production, and the need for any elevation changes or inclines. The conveyor system should be designed to fit seamlessly into the facility and optimize the production process.

Furthermore, the conveyor system's material of construction is a critical factor to consider. Food-grade conveyor systems are typically made of stainless steel, as it is durable, corrosion-resistant, and easy to clean. However, there are different grades and types of stainless steel, so it's essential to select the right material that is suitable for the specific food processing environment.

Lastly, consider the regulatory requirements and standards that apply to food processing equipment. The conveyor system should comply with food safety regulations, such as those set forth by the FDA, USDA, and other relevant authorities. Additionally, the conveyor system should be designed and manufactured to meet industry standards for food safety and sanitation.

Types of Food-Grade Systems

There are several types of food-grade conveyor systems available, each designed for specific applications and production needs. The following are some of the most common types of food-grade conveyor systems used in the food industry.

Belt conveyors are the most widely used type of conveyor system in food processing. They consist of a continuous belt that moves over a series of rollers or pulleys, transporting food products from one location to another. Belt conveyors are suitable for transporting a wide range of food products, including raw ingredients, packaged goods, and more.

Screw conveyors are designed to move bulk materials, such as powders, granules, and flakes, in a controlled and efficient manner. They consist of a rotating helical screw that moves the materials along the conveyor trough. Screw conveyors are commonly used in the food industry for conveying ingredients, such as flour, sugar, or spices, as well as for transferring materials between processing equipment.

Bucket elevators are used to vertically lift and transport bulk materials in a continuous stream. They are commonly used in food processing facilities for handling dry or fragile materials, such as grains, fruits, or vegetables. The buckets, attached to a rotating belt or chain, scoop up the materials from the bottom of the elevator and discharge them at the top, allowing for gentle handling and minimal damage to the products.

Wire mesh conveyors are ideal for applications that require air and liquid flow through the conveyor belt. They are commonly used in the food industry for cooling, washing, drying, and draining operations. The open design of the wire mesh belt allows for easy cleaning and sanitation, making them suitable for hygienic food processing environments.

Msimu belt conveyor s are versatile and customizable conveyor systems that consist of interlocking plastic modules linked together to form a continuous belt. They are suitable for a wide range of food processing applications, including inclines, declines, and horizontal transportation. The modular design allows for easy and quick assembly, disassembly, and maintenance of the conveyor system.

These are just a few examples of the types of food-grade conveyor systems available, and there is a wide range of other conveyor systems designed for specific applications and production needs in the food industry.

Key Features to Look for in a Food-Grade System

When selecting a food-grade conveyor system, there are several key features to look for to ensure that it meets the requirements of your food processing operation. The following are some of the essential features to consider when choosing a conveyor system for handling food products.

First and foremost, the conveyor system should be designed for ease of cleaning and sanitation. Look for features such as removable parts, cleanable surfaces, and open-frame construction that allow for thorough cleaning and maintenance. The conveyor system should also have minimal horizontal surfaces, nooks, and crannies where food residue can accumulate, reducing the risk of contamination.

In addition to cleanliness, the conveyor system should be designed for reliable and efficient operation. Look for features such as durable construction, reliable components, and minimal maintenance requirements. The system should be designed to withstand the rigors of the food processing environment and provide consistent performance to ensure the smooth flow of production.

Another important feature to consider is the flexibility and adaptability of the conveyor system. It should be able to accommodate changes in production requirements, such as different product sizes, shapes, and weights. Look for features such as adjustable speed, height, and angle, as well as modular design that allows for easy customization and reconfiguration of the conveyor system.

Hygienic design is essential for food-grade conveyor systems, and features such as stainless steel construction, sanitary welding, and smooth, crevice-free surfaces are crucial for ensuring food safety and compliance with regulatory standards. The conveyor system should also have features such as self-draining surfaces, sloped frames, and sanitary conveyor belting to prevent the buildup of moisture and debris.

Furthermore, consider the safety features of the conveyor system, such as guarding, emergency stop controls, and safety interlock systems. The conveyor system should be designed to minimize the risk of accidents and injuries, protecting both workers and the food products being handled.

Lastly, consider the energy efficiency and sustainability of the conveyor system. Look for features such as energy-saving motors, variable speed drives, and efficient use of resources to minimize the environmental impact of the conveyor system. Choosing a sustainable conveyor system can help reduce operating costs and align with the goals of environmental responsibility.

Benefits of Using a Food-Grade System

Implementing a food-grade conveyor system in your food processing operation offers a wide range of benefits that can improve efficiency, safety, and product quality. The following are some of the key benefits of using a food-grade conveyor system in the food industry.

One of the primary benefits of using a food-grade conveyor system is the improvement in productivity and efficiency. systems automate the transportation of food products throughout the production process, reducing the need for manual handling and streamlining the flow of materials. This can result in increased throughput, reduced labor costs, and improved overall efficiency in the food processing operation.

Another significant benefit of using a food-grade conveyor system is the enhancement of food safety and sanitation. systems are designed for easy cleaning and sanitizing, reducing the risk of contamination and ensuring compliance with food safety regulations. The smooth, cleanable surfaces and hygienic design of the conveyor system help maintain the quality and integrity of the food products being handled.

In addition to safety, the use of a food-grade conveyor system can also improve the quality and appearance of food products. Gentle handling and precise control provided by conveyor systems can minimize product damage and degradation, resulting in higher-quality finished products. Additionally, conveyor systems can be designed to provide cooling, freezing, or other processing operations to enhance the overall quality of the food products.

Furthermore, the implementation of a food-grade conveyor system can contribute to cost savings and operational efficiency. By automating material handling and streamlining the production process, conveyor systems can reduce labor costs, minimize product waste, and optimize the use of resources. This can lead to improved profitability and a more sustainable operation.

Lastly, using a food-grade conveyor system can provide a competitive advantage in the food industry. Consumers and regulatory agencies are increasingly focused on food safety, quality, and sustainability, and having a hygienic, efficient conveyor system in place can help demonstrate a commitment to these priorities. This can lead to improved customer satisfaction, market differentiation, and a positive brand image for your food products.

In summary, selecting the best food-grade conveyor system for your needs requires careful consideration of factors such as product requirements, hygienic design, facility layout, material of construction, regulatory compliance, and more. There are various types of food-grade conveyor systems available, each with its unique applications and benefits, and it's essential to choose a system that aligns with your specific production requirements. By considering key features and benefits, you can ensure that the selected conveyor system meets the safety, quality, and efficiency needs of your food processing operation, providing a competitive advantage and contributing to the overall success of your business.
